Dropping a satellite requires a right click and then hovering over "civilian" and then left clicking on "satellite". If you're deploying 50 satellites at a time then that's a ton of repeated actions when it'd be easier to have an option like "Deploy Multiple" where it'll let you keep clicking drop coordinates continuously.

This would also made it much easier to set up minefields and laser turret arrays.

The 3.00 beta changelog relating to this aspect so far includes:

Added option to (de)activate multiple deployables at once.
Removed 500m restriction for (de)activating deployables.
Fixed excessive delays when ordering a ship to deploy deployables at a location.

It appears from there that the multiple aspect that changed applies more to activation and deactivation in situ rather than deployment or placement. I could be wrong though.
